Какая универсальная формула используется для определения среднего числа при использовании функции clamp()?

Как можно получить универсальную формулу для функции clamp в CSS без использования специальных генераторов, чтобы найти среднее значение между минимальным и максимальным, аналогично делению максимального значения на условную единицу?
  • 6 июля 2024 г. 19:52
Ответы на вопрос 1
Универсальная формула для определения среднего числа при использовании функции clamp() будет выглядеть следующим образом:

clamp(MIN + (MAX - MIN) * k, MIN, MAX),

где MIN - минимальное значение, MAX - максимальное значение, а k - число от 0 до 1, которое определяет, насколько близко к максимальному значению будет наше среднее значение.

Пример использования формулы:

clamp(100px + (200px - 100px) * 0.5, 100px, 200px) - это вернет среднее значение между 100px и 200px, равное 150px.

Таким образом, вы можете использовать данную универсальную формулу для определения среднего числа при использовании функции clamp() в CSS.
Похожие вопросы